Thought about it and with the 4amp 115 charger (not the less 112 or 107), battery, bag and a couple blades, went ahead and bought 2 for Christmas presents. I have the XR and besides the XR's 20,000 to the Atomic's 18,000 oscillations per minute, cannot tell the difference between the two.
That 115 charger and 2 amp battery will themselves make a nice gift.... at least $50 worth, leaving you the bag, tool and a couple blades..... all with a long return window if needed.
This is the one tool that I was looking to go Atomic vs XR with. I always seem to want my corded.one to be just a hair smaller...the small size can really help with this guy, and the Atomic doesn't look too gimped compared to the XR.
